New options to create and share on Instagram have been launched. You may now collaborate on posts with up to 3 pals, add music to carousels, and join creators with the Add Yours sticker.


Users will be able to share more music, images, and movies with their friends and followers thanks to new capabilities that Instagram has revealed. With the new contribute Yours sticker, you may now join creators, invite up to 3 collaborators, and contribute music to carousels.




According to the social media site, the new capabilities are intended to make creating and sharing content on Instagram simpler and more enjoyable. Here is a list of these features along with instructions on how to utilise them.


How to make carousels play music

Users could only currently add music to individual photographs on their postings. That has changed with the most recent upgrade, which gives picture carousels—groups of many photographs in a single post—the option to play music. Users may customise their carousel's ambiance by selecting a song from Instagram's music collection.


1. On your phone, launch the Instagram app, then touch the + icon at the bottom of the screen.


2. To make a carousel, choose the pictures you wish to share from your gallery or snap some new ones using the camera.


3. At the top of the screen, select Add music. You may choose a song from the list or do a search of our music collection.


4. To select whatever section of the music you wish to play along with your image, use the sliding bar at the bottom. The music's volume and duration may both be changed.


5. Select Done and Next to include a caption, location, and other choices. To submit your picture with music, select Share.


How to cooperate with two or more individuals

Collaborative posts, carousels, and reels may now be co-authored by up to three pals thanks to another new feature called Collabs. The credit and audience for the material, which will show up on each account's profile grid, will be split among the contributors. This function works with both private and public accounts as long as they follow one another.


1. Tap Tag individuals while submitting your post.


2. Click Invite team members.


3. Conduct a search for and choose the accounts you want to include as collaborators.


4. Click Done. If they agree to work together, their followers will see your article.


The new Add Yours sticker: How to use it

The Add Yours sticker, which is the third new feature, lets creators and artists invite their fans to participate in a silly prompt or challenge they post on Reels. The author or artist may choose which of their fans' entries they choose to highlight on their Reel.


1. Tap the sticker that reads "Add yours" if you see it on a reel.


2. A page featuring reels from other individuals who have joined the fun will be displayed to you.


3. To record your own Reel, select Add yours at the bottom of the page.


4. If their Reel is picked, the followers will be alerted, and others can view it by touching the Add Yours sticker.
